Substance is not a document.
Before anyone names a country, the question is where the decisions are actually taken. The answer is a fact, and it is rarely the one on the certificate.
The country is chosen first.
The sequence in the market is jurisdiction, then entity, then a substance package bought to fit. The sequence that survives inspection runs the other way, and it begins with a function the business actually performs.
A structure is not tested against its design. It is tested against its own behavior, years later, in hindsight, on facts nobody was curating at the time because nobody expected to be asked.
Three tests, one factual question.
Substance is not one concept. Three different regimes ask a version of the same factual question, at three different moments, through three different authorities, and none of them accepts paper as the answer to it.
Treating them as variants of one another produces a file that answers one regime and fails the other two. In one, substance is a defense against having an operation set aside. In another it is a positive condition of eligibility for a rate, tested continuously.
The failure modes diverge, and the divergence is not priced at the design stage. One costs a transaction and its penalties. The other can cost the tax position of a business model for several years at once.
Adequacy is tested per activity.
Adequacy of people, of assets and of expenditure is not measured once at the level of the entity. It is measured against each activity the entity claims to perform, and the claims are made by the entity.
The same person cannot be counted twice. Someone overseeing treasury is not also the headcount that makes manufacturing adequate, and an entity that counts one manager into four activities has demonstrated the opposite of adequacy.
A provider's staff, premises and costs, shared across many licensees at once and counted in full for each, are adequate for none of them.
Profit has to follow function.
A thin functional profile caps what an entity can defensibly earn, even where every formal condition has been met. Where the profit booked exceeds the function performed, the file argues against itself.
Pricing is therefore not a parallel workstream that follows the structuring. It is part of the eligibility question, and in several regimes it is written into the conditions themselves.
The owner did not relocate.
The corporate analysis is rarely where the case is lost. The entity relocates, the owner does not: days of presence, family, home and the center of economic interests remain where they always were, and are counted later.
A residence certificate is one item of proof, not an answer to the question being asked. The question is about presence and about links that were never severed, and a certificate speaks to neither of them.
Several origin countries reverse the burden where the move is to a listed jurisdiction. The structure is then defended by the individual, from a position he did not choose.
The reason has to predate the plan.
A commercial rationale is worth what its date is worth. It has to have existed and been recorded before the operation, in board papers or investment committee papers, and stated in terms of markets, access, counterparty risk or proximity.
A rationale drafted after the assessment arrives is visible as such. It uses the vocabulary of the assessment, answers the objection rather than the business, and is dated accordingly.
The test is blunt and it is applied by the owner, not by an adviser. Asked to state the reason for the structure without using the word tax, the owner either can or he cannot, and both answers are files.
The file, not the diagram.
Every one of these tests resolves into evidence generated at the time, which is the part that cannot be retrofitted. Minutes that record deliberation and choice, not ratification of decisions already taken elsewhere.
A headcount and a cost map drawn activity by activity. Pricing that tracks the functions performed. Decision makers physically present where the decisions are said to have been made, on the dates recorded.
Above all, symmetry between the legal form and the economic behavior. The classic failures are asymmetries: the manager who signs from the origin country, the holding company that also invoices services, the certificate treated as a conclusion.
One question, asked early.
Repriced at a rate that removes the advantage entirely, the structure is either still worth building or it is not. The answer takes a minute and it is decisive.
If the honest answer is no, the file will not survive contact with any of the three regimes. The absence it will be asked to explain is the absence the answer has just admitted.
Substance is not a document, a certificate, an address or a package sold with an entity. It is the record of a business that did what it said it did, made where it said it made it. That record is built in advance or it is not built at all.
